I just saw this one this morning. It's Jarvis and the song is called "Don't Let Him Waste Your Time". Featuring Jarvis as a singing taxi driver who during the course of journey frequently takes his hands off the wheel and turns round leaving the car to run up the pavement, run people over etc. it's a good video.
